Daimen Hunter entered the Hall of Fame third all-time on the scoring list at Alvernia with 2,242 points, second all-time in points per game (20.4). He holds the school record for free throw attempts (619) and steals (218) and his 52 free throws made in the 1997 NCAA Tournament still stands, as of his induction, as the individual record for free throws made in a tournament.
Hunter earned a number of individual accolades. He was the 1995 ECAC South Rookie of the Year and the 1997 Dick Vitale Preseason Division III Player of the Year. He followed that up with his first of two straight PAC Player of the Year awards. He was named to the 1997 All-American First Team and the Columbus Multimedia Mid-Atlantic and National Player of the Year.
